#30. Parenting Quote of the Week

August 19, 2007 by kate baggott  
Filed under Finances

If you are a stay-at-home mother and starting your own business, be sure to plan for solid daycare and housekeeping, even cooking while you are focussed upon your new business. For those women who have always worked and employ nannies or daycare, don’t be fooled into thinking you can do it all just because you are working out of the house.

– Mary-Ann Massad Johnson in Move from Employee to CEO of Your Own Destiny: A Woman’s Guide to Entrepreneurship and Wealth.
